​Cumann na mBunscol mini 7s CHAMPIONS 2022/2023 !!!

Picture
 

Lurga played Mountbellew NS in the first match and won 3.12 to 4 points with great goals from Cian and Danny and great performances from Luke, Fiachra and Cian. 
Our second Match v Gael Scoil Daragh - we won comprehensively 4.11 to 2 points with great performances from Iarlaith, Donncha, Theo and Eoghan. Thereby we qualified to the semi final to play Carnmore and won by 2.9 to 1.3 with goals from Cian and Evan and great performances from both boys.

In the Final we played against Duniry NS and after a poor start we got on top through outstanding performances from Donncha, Mark and Iarlaith at the back and Theo and Cian further up the field eventually winning by 3.5 to 5 points.

Great teamwork and a never say die attitude were hallmarks of the Team.  Massively supported by Pat Loughnane and Finbar Gantley  and managed astutely by Ms Lundon Scanlon and Mrs Moroney, and roared on by their small band of loyal supporters. 
Heartbreak for Bobby Walsh who couldn't play on the day and for Morgan Waterhouse and Eoin Scanlon who were overage but encouraged the team for every step of play.  Also special mention to our neighbouring school Lough Cultra's students, teachers and parents, who stay on to roar support to our boys.  A massive achievement to have come out top in a competition played by all schools in Galway.

The Team consisted of Donncha Glynn, Iarlaith Veale, Mark Fahy, Theo Gantley, Evan Gantley, Cian Loughnane, Fiachra Connolly 
Eoghan Kirrane, Luke Foster, Danny Gantley
